MyNetworkTV Selects TANDBERG Television Satellite Distribution Solution for Network Launch


Delivery of High Quality Video Enabled by the TANDBERG Television Director v5 Network Management and Receiver Control System

ATLANTA-Sept. 1, 2006-TANDBERG Television (OSE:TAT) today announced that MyNetworkTV, the new primetime television network with 167 affiliates representing 96% of U.S. TV households, has chosen TANDBERG Television to provide both high definition and standard definition MPEG-2 encoding solutions for its launch on September 5, 2006. The win marks the sixth U.S. broadcast network currently using TANDBERG Television systems for satellite distribution of network programming to affiliates. Implementation of the new system will enable MyNetworkTV, the only high definition broadcast television network in the U.S., to deploy a robust satellite distribution system, enabling the highest quality of video for the launch of the new network this fall.

At its network origination center in Los Angeles, MyNetworkTV will deploy TANDBERG Television's E5710 and E5780 MPEG-2 SD and HD encoders, MX5620 multiplexers, and Director v5 network management and receiver control system. Each affiliate, depending on its use of either the SD or HD feed (or both), will deploy a TT1260 MPEG-2 SD or TT1280 MPEG-2 HD professional receiver.

The TANDBERG Television Director system is an industry-leading solution designed to both manage encoding systems at the point of program origination via TANDBERG nCompass Control and remotely control and manage up to 50,000 receivers deployed in the field. The newest Director release differs from earlier versions of the system in that no smart cards are required for receiver control; the security is embedded inside the receivers.

The capabilities of Director enable broadcasters to schedule programming or entitlement changes in advance, download new software to receivers over the air or securely encrypt the content being distributed, and individually or by group entitle receivers to view the content. More importantly, networks and other users are able to mix and match functionality and choose only those features they need, thereby controlling their costs. About MyNetworkTV

Scheduled to launch on September 5, 2006, and targeted to adults 18-49, MyNetworkTV is the first all high definition broadcast network and will feature Twentieth Television's new scripted primetime drama strips "Desire" and "Fashion House," starring Bo Derek and Morgan Fairchild. The hour-long programs will feature a 65-episode story arc stripped Monday through Friday over the span of 13 weeks. Each Saturday, a re-cap episode highlighting the two programs' previous week's storylines will air. "Desire" follows two close brothers on the run from the mafia who both fall in love with, and then passionately battle for, the same woman. "Fashion House" takes an in-depth look at the dreams, successes and tragedies found everyday in the fashion industry.
